One killed, 14 injured as tourist bus falls off bridge on NH-16 in Balasore
Bhubaneswar, Feb 13: A tragic road accident claimed one life and left 14 others seriously injured after a tourist bus crashed off a bridge on National Highway-16 at Khantapada in Balasore on Thursday.
According to reports, the bus was carrying more than 50 passengers and was en route from West Bengal to Andhra Pradesh when the mishap occurred. Preliminary findings suggest that the driver allegedly dozed off while driving, causing him to lose control of the vehicle. The bus then veered off the bridge, leading to the devastating accident.
The impact of the crash was severe. The driver was thrown off the bridge and died on the spot due to critical injuries. Fourteen passengers sustained serious injuries in the incident, while several others suffered minor bruises and shock.
All the injured were rescued by locals and emergency responders and rushed to Khantapada Community Health Centre for treatment. Medical teams are closely monitoring their condition.
Meanwhile, the damaged bus remains precariously hanging from the bridge, and authorities have initiated measures to safely remove the vehicle and restore normal traffic movement.
